数据库恢复备份全流程指南企业级5步恢复法与实战案例
数据库恢复备份全流程指南:企业级5步恢复法与实战案例
在数字化转型的浪潮中,数据库作为企业核心业务的中枢神经,其安全性直接关系到企业运营的连续性。根据IDC最新报告显示,全球每年因数据丢失造成的经济损失高达8200亿美元,其中73%的企业因未及时恢复备份而陷入瘫痪状态。本文将深入企业级数据库恢复备份的完整流程,结合真实案例与实操技巧,帮助企业构建从数据备份到灾后恢复的全链路解决方案。
一、数据库恢复前的关键准备工作
1. 备份介质检查与版本管理
选择符合ISO 23837标准的存储介质时,需特别注意RAID冗余配置与冷热备存储方案。某电商平台曾因误将RAID5系统误设为RAID1,导致恢复时数据校验失败。建议采用3-2-1备份法则(3份副本、2种介质、1份异地),并建立包含时间戳、版本号、MD5校验值的备份档案。
2. 恢复环境搭建规范
搭建独立的恢复环境时,需严格遵循"三隔离原则":物理隔离(不同服务器)、网络隔离(独立VLAN)、存储隔离(专用恢复存储池)。某金融机构在通过部署NVIDIA DPU智能网卡,将恢复环境搭建时间从传统模式的6小时缩短至38分钟。
3. 工具链配置与认证
推荐采用开源工具链(如 restoresys + xtrabackup + rsync)与商业产品(如Veeam Backup & Replication)的混合架构。特别要注意数据库认证文件的加密存储,某银行系统曾因未加密的pg_hba.conf导致恢复过程泄露敏感信息。
二、企业级数据库恢复5步法
1. 数据源定位与完整性校验
使用数据库探针工具(如dbForge Data Compare)扫描存储系统,识别符合备份时间戳的卷组。某跨国集团通过部署Ceph对象存储系统,实现EB级数据的秒级定位。校验环节需执行MD5/SHA-256双校验,某物流公司曾因未检测到备份文件篡改,导致恢复后数据错误率高达12%。
2. 介质解密与数据恢复
采用硬件级加密(如LTO-9驱动器内置加密)与软件解密结合的方式。某证券公司的案例显示,使用AES-256加密的备份数据恢复失败率从0.07%降至0.002%。特别要注意加密密钥的动态管理,建议采用HSM硬件安全模块存储。
3. 分阶段恢复实施
- 系统层恢复:部署自动化部署工具(如Ansible)执行恢复脚本
- 数据层恢复:采用增量恢复策略(如MySQL的binlog恢复)
- 应用层恢复:通过API网关实现灰度发布(某电商系统恢复期间业务中断时间从2小时压缩至23分钟)
4. 恢复验证与性能测试
5. 恢复后运营管理
执行包含日志归档(使用BorgBackup)、备份更新(每日增量备份)、版本升级(遵循Backward Compatibility原则)的持续运维流程。某跨国企业的实践表明,建立自动化恢复演练机制可将平均故障恢复时间(MTTR)从7小时降低至29分钟。
三、常见问题与预防措施
1. 恢复失败场景处理
- 数据损坏:使用dbForge Data恢复工具重建页表
- 逻辑错误:执行REPAIR TABLE修复索引

- 事务不一致:采用XACTómatic工具回滚未提交事务
2. 新技术适配方案
- 云数据库:采用跨区域备份(如AWS RDS跨可用区复制)
- NoSQL数据库:实施文档级恢复(MongoDB的备份恢复)
- 时序数据库:使用滚动恢复(InfluxDB的持续备份)
3. 合规性保障
- GDPR合规:建立数据恢复审计日志(保存期限≥5年)
- 等保2.0:通过三级等保中的"数据备份恢复"专项测评
- 行业规范:满足金融行业《金融数据安全分级指南》要求
四、典型案例分析
1. 某电商平台双十一灾备演练
- 演练目标:在15分钟内完成TB级数据恢复
- 实施过程:采用蓝绿部署+增量同步技术
- 成果:成功恢复98.7%订单数据,RPO=1分钟,RTO=12分钟
2. 某医院电子病历系统恢复
- 关键挑战:HL7医疗数据标准兼容性
- 解决方案:定制化HL7恢复工具
- 成果:3小时内恢复5年历史病历数据
五、未来技术趋势
1. 智能恢复技术
- 机器学习预测恢复时间(准确率92.3%)
- 知识图谱辅助数据定位(某案例定位效率提升60%)
2. 新型存储介质应用
- DNA存储:实现PB级数据10年保存(微软已实现1GB文件)
- 光子存储:某实验室实现1EB数据毫秒级访问
3. 自动化恢复体系
- 混合云自动切换(AWS/Azure/GCP多供应商支持)
- 智能备份优先级算法(根据业务价值动态调整)
数据库恢复备份绝非简单的数据复制,而是一个涉及存储架构、网络拓扑、安全认证、合规审计的复杂系统工程。通过构建"预防-备份-恢复-验证"的全生命周期管理体系,企业可将数据丢失带来的业务中断风险降低至0.001%以下。建议每季度进行一次恢复演练,每年更新灾备方案,结合业务变化动态调整备份策略,真正实现"数据安全即业务安全"的数字化转型目标。